Summary:
The Administrative Assistant provides administrative, technological, and general office support to the Program. A commitment to the RHD values should be demonstrated as job duties are performed.

Essential Duties and Functions:
Administrative
Assists in the processing of new hire paperwork, and other staff related documents.
Creates and manages employee files, filing new paperwork, as needed.
Submits staff payroll data to generate staff payroll checks.
Requests payment for program vendor bills, and orders program supplies, as needed.
Provides initial reconciliation of cash advances and custodial, with further review via Accounts Payable department.
Functions as program representative, answering phones, greeting guests, and assisting staff with program matters.
Conducts basic Medicaid/Medicare Fraud Eligibility Screens if required by program funding source for new hires.
Responsible for handling and management of consumer/participant s charts/books/files containing protected health information (HIRST).
Maintain and track all staff training requirements state regs and compliance including mandatory physicals.
Other duties as assigned.
